Ordinals
beta
Address 1PTZDWZLxW6t2d7ENEhdCg7ZwN2fr64HvK
sat balance
11472
runes balances
outputs
95a5873979c7d711ecee89e74a804bf9c6e1839a9d6cb04c5a9ac45ed6b65e50:0
30e3362f2b1c870ab9cb7ece260a61fd6f6b28f5679b06f7112dd004501ac5d7:0